The HIM ROI Analyst, Release of Records is responsible for processing all release of information requests for medical information for the Hospital in a timely and efficient manner. Understand and abide by the State and Federal guidelines, HIPAA, Title X, and 1976 Privacy Act. Stay informed of changing legislation affecting Release of Information processes. At all times safeguard and protect the patient's right to privacy by ensuring that only authorized individuals have access to minimum necessary medical information. Ensure all disclosures are documented and are in compliance with the request, authorization, Hospital policy and the State and Federal regulations.
